CD20 Operational Overview
Location & Facility
SPRAGUE (CD20) is a privately owned airport restricted to private use located in LOVELAND, Colorado, United States. The field sits at an elevation of 5,603 feet above mean sea level (MSL) at coordinates 40.4750°N, 105.2202°W.
Runways
SPRAGUE has 1 runway. The longest runway (16/34) measures 1,750 feet by 40 feet with a asph surface.
Communications & Operations
SPRAGUE is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) field.
